Essential Ingredients for Cooking Turkey Drumsticks

To achieve perfect turkey drumsticks, you will need the following ingredients:

  • 4 turkey drumsticks
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 1 tablespoon garlic powder
  • 1 tablespoon onion powder
  • 1 tablespoon smoked paprika
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• 1 cup chicken broth or stock
  • Fresh herbs (optional, such as thyme or rosemary)

Step-by-Step Guide to Cook Turkey Drumsticks

Step 1: Prepare the Turkey Drumsticks

Before cooking, it’s essential to prepare the turkey drumsticks properly:

  • Rinse the turkey drumsticks under cold water and pat them dry with paper towels.
  • Trim any excess skin or fat if necessary.

Step 2: Season the Drumsticks

Seasoning is key to flavorful turkey drumsticks:

  • In a small bowl, mix olive oil, garlic powder, onion powder, smoked paprika, salt, and pepper.
  • Rub the mixture all over the turkey drumsticks, ensuring they are well coated.

Step 3: Choose Your Cooking Method

There are several methods to cook turkey drumsticks. Here are three popular options:

Oven Roasting
  1.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C).
  2. Place the seasoned drumsticks on a baking sheet or in a roasting pan.
  3. Pour the chicken broth around the drumsticks.
  4. Roast in the oven for about 1.5 to 2 hours, or until the internal temperature reaches 165°F (74°C).
  5. Baste the drumsticks with the broth every 30 minutes for added moisture.
Grilling
  1. Preheat your grill to medium-high heat.
  2. Place the seasoned drumsticks on the grill and cook for about 30-40 minutes, turning occasionally.
  3. Use a meat thermometer to check for an internal temperature of 165°F (74°C).
Slow Cooking
  1. Place the seasoned drumsticks in a slow cooker.
  2. Add chicken broth and any desired vegetables (like carrots and potatoes).
  3. Cook on low for 6-8 hours or high for 3-4 hours.

Troubleshooting Tips for Cooking Turkey Drumsticks

Even with the best intentions, things can go wrong. Here are some troubleshooting tips:

  • Dry Drumsticks: If your turkey drumsticks turn out dry, make sure you baste them regularly and keep the cooking temperature moderate.
  • Undercooked Drumsticks: Always use a meat thermometer to check for doneness. The internal temperature should reach 165°F (74°C).
  • Bland Flavor: If your drumsticks lack flavor, try marinating them overnight before cooking or adding more seasoning.
  • Uneven Cooking: Ensure that drumsticks are of similar size for even cooking, and rotate them occasionally during cooking.
